Bierazcy
Bierazcy is a hamlet in Brest Oblast, Belarus and has about 208 residents. Bierazcy is situated nearby to the locality Стыр, as well as near Ламань.- Type: Hamlet with 208 residents
- Description: village in Pinsk district, Belarus
- Also known as: “Bereztsy”

Kallaurowicze or Kałłaurowicze is a village in the Pinsk District of Brest Region, Belarus, located at the mouth of the Styr River near its confluence with the Pripyat River. Kałłaurowicze is situated 8 km southwest of Bierazcy.
